Security programming in python book pdf

Pythons simplicity lets you become productive quickly, but this often means you arent using everything it has to offer. Click download or read online button to get advanced scratch programming book. Network security download free books programming book. This book will prove helpful to students of class xi and xii, affiliated to central board of secondary education india. Pycrypto rsa generate an rsa secret and public key pair from crypto. Downey recently released a python 3 version of his book. This is the code repository for mastering python for networking and security, published by packt. He is the author of gray hat python no starch press, the first book to cover python for security analysis.

Great share it is great that there is so much free educational resources and freedom for everyone to explore programming without it we would. Python for cyber security professionals national initiative. Computer programming and cyber security for beginners. Downey, who wrote the excellent python 2 book think python. If you found this free python book useful, then please share it getting started with python language. I am a 18 year old it student studying at university in. Justin seitz is a senior security researcher for immunity, inc.

In this link you must download free many programming books. Use features like bookmarks, note taking and highlighting while reading python. Since you have no idea about python, it means you are a complete beginner in python. Sumita arora python book pdf class 11 and class 12. Python programming for digital forensics and security analysis. Grayhatpythonpythonprogrammingforhackersandreverseengineers. It can replace hping, arpspoof, arpsk, arping, p0f and even some parts of nmap, tcpdump, and tshark. This book will set you up with a foundation that will help you understand the advanced concepts of hacking in the future. Having these tutorials together in an ebook format provides you with a resource that you can use on your favorite ereader without maintaining a constant internet connection. Python is the best language for beginners to learn programming. Its an attempt to make cyber security simple, to acquaint you with the basics, and to provide you with easy things you can do to protect your family and your business from those who would use a computer to do. About python python is an open source programming language. Optional arguments are the starting integer and a stride. Violent python a cookbook for hackers, forensic analysts, penetration testers and security engineers.

Or the book could be used in a second course that is preceded by an introductory programming course of the usual kind. Pdf mastering python for networking and security researchgate. Otherwise, the ideal reader is someone who has had at least some experience with programming, using either python or another programming language. Python crash course teaches you basics python fundamental.

Which is the best book to learn python for hacking and pen. Ebook programming with python download pdf technology diver. You may prefer a machine readable copy of this book. The goal of this book is to teach anyone how to create useful programs in python. Youll start with the big picture and then dive into language syntax, programming techniques, and other details, using examples that illustrate both correct usage and common idioms. To get your hands on practice to learn this programming language for penetration testing and hack, get this book and. Free pdf book for developper python for security professionals.

These examples are intended to build a comprehensive picture of how network clients, network servers. Beginning programming with python for dummies, 2nd edition pdf. So, i am going to list all the books from beginner level to a penetration testers level. He is the author of gray hat python, the first book to cover. Cyber security and python programming stepbystep guides kindle edition by studios, hacking. In preparing this book the python documentation at. There are a number of latexpackages, particularly listings and hyperref, that were particulary helpful. Oct 22, 2017 hackingbooks violent python a cookbook for hackers, forensic analysts, penetration testers and security engineers. Need a handy reference book for looking up documentation or recipes. This updated programming php, 4th edition teaches everything you need to know to create effective web applications using the latest features in php 7. Contribute to tanc7hacking books development by creating an account on github. Write your first python program, a dictionary password cracker.

Leverage python scripts and libraries to overcome networking and security issues. The first half of this book, youll introduce to fundamental of python programming. Python programming for hackers and reverse engineers justin seitz. Learn the most popular programming language in terms of security and penetration testing from this great book learn python the hard way pdf. Text content is released under creative commons bysa. Netis a package which provides near seamless integration of a natively installed python installation with the. Free pdf book for developperpython for security professionals course. Ample number of diagrams are used to illustrate the subject matter for easy understanding.

Mastering python for networking and security github. Download advanced scratch programming or read advanced scratch programming online books in pdf, epub and mobi format. He is the author of gray hat python, the first book to cover python for security analysis. Python determines the type of the reference automatically based on the data object assigned to it. Author luciano ramalho takes you through pythons core. Python wrapper for the origami ruby module which sanitizes pdf files. They guide you through a few realistic applications of python. Either can leave you wondering if you will be the next victim. It should be usable by secondary school students, and university and college students for whom computer programming is not naturally incorporated in their course program. This book describes a set of guidelines for writing secure programs. For information on book distributors or translations, please contact no starch press, inc. A catalogue record for this book is available from the british library. Instead, this book focuses on network programming, using python 3 for every example script and snippet of code at the python prompt. One of the many uses of the versatile python programming language is in digital forensics and security analysis.

Such programs include application programs used as viewers of. The style of programming in this book is geared towards the kinds of programming things i like to. He sent me a copy of his translation, and i had the unusual experience of learning python by reading my own book. This book is for the majority of people who arent involved in cyber security for a living. This topic contains 42 replies, has 39 voices, and was last updated by janshakti 2 years, 2 months ago. Programming with python language is explained with maximum number of examples. This book is designed to give you an insight of the art and science of computers. Develop python scripts for automating security and pentesting tasks discover the python standard librarys main modules used for performing security related tasks automate analytical tasks and the extraction of information from servers explore processes for detecting and exploiting. I myself learned python programming from his book, and used the latex template that he graciously provided as the basis for this book.

This is the inverse approach to that taken by ironpython see above, to which it is more complementary than competing with. The style of programming in this book is geared towards the kinds of programming things i like to doshort programs, often of a mathematical nature, small utilities to make my life easier, and small. Assignment creates references, not copies names in python do not have an intrinsic type. Apr 17, 2020 by the end of the python oneliners book, youll know how to write python at its most refined, and create concise, beautiful pieces of python art in merely a single line. This handson course will provide students demos and lessons on python basics and walk through labs portraying the usefulness python has in a variety of information security areas. If all you know about computers is how to save text files, then this is the book for you. Scapy is a python program that enables the user to send, sniff and dissect and forge network packets. I have checked the contents of c and python book, and i can say these are quality books. Students will have guided instruction and walk through programming in python.

The python not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. Binding a variable in python means setting a name to hold a reference to some object. For this reason, this book is organized into three parts. Jan 29, 2020 learn the most popular programming language in terms of security and penetration testing from this great book learn python the hard way pdf. The fundamentals of python python for machine learning. This article covers various aspects like socket programming, port scanning, geolocation and extraction of data from websites like twitter. The constant news about hacking can be very frightening. This book is for complete beginners who have never programmed before. Home forums courses python for security professionals course free pdf book for developper tagged. This section contains the best reference books and cookbooks.

For purposes of this book, a secure program is a program that sits on a security boundary, taking input from a source that does not have the same access rights as the program. Pdf see other formats python programming for hackers part 1 getting started python for hacker course outline intro. Download this book for free on audible by clicking on the kindle cover and follow the link one of the biggest myths about python programing is. Jeff elkner, a high school teacher in virginia, adopted my book and translated it into python. Thong tin chung programming with python ten tai li. Python programming for hackers and pentesters akakom repository.

About the author justin seitz is a senior security researcher for immunity, inc. This capability allows construction of tools that can probe, scan or attack networks. Find file copy path tanc7 add files via upload 2456e7e oct. Begin ethical hacking with python ebook pdf hackingvision. With this handson guide, youll learn how to write effective, idiomatic python code by leveraging its bestand possibly most neglectedfeatures.

Each lab builds upon the next allowing for guided instruction. A beginners guide to python programming for machine learning and deep learning, data analysis, algorithms and data science with scikit learn, tensorflow, pytorch and keras heres a sneak peek of what youll learn with this book. This book teaches basic programming concepts with the python programming language. It serves as a tutorial or guide to the python language for a beginner audience. Pdf its becoming more and more apparent that security is a critical. Mar 17, 2020 this updated programming php, 4th edition teaches everything you need to know to create effective web applications using the latest features in php 7. Python is one of the most used programming language for hacking and penetration testing. Download it once and read it on your kindle device, pc, phones or tablets. Youll be given an overview of how imports, modules, and packages work in python, how you can handle errors to prevent apps from crashing, as well as file manipulation.

You can also get this pdf by using our android mobile app directly. A cookbook for hackers, forensic analysts, penetration testers and. There is no prior programming experience required and the book is loved by liberal arts majors and geeks alike. Digitaloceans how to code in python 3 tutorial series is available for free as an open educational ebook in both epub and pdf formats. Owasp python security project a new ambitious project that aims at making python more secure and viable for usage in sensitive environments. Learn ethical hacking with python 3 touches the core issues of cybersecurity. Cyber security and python programming stepbystep guides. Cyber security and python programming stepbystep guides studios, hacking on. Solved exercises are added at the end of each chapter so that the readers can evaluate their progress. You know the basics of python and want to apply it in realistic projects.

By the end of the python oneliners book, youll know how to write python at its most refined, and create concise, beautiful pieces of python art in merely a single line. If the keyboard security program is not installed, the user name, password, and public. But this book is not designed to cover everything, and i recommend reading other books and the python documentation to. Development started by guido van rossum in december 1989. Contribute to manhnhopythonbooksforsecurity development by creating. Cyber security download free books programming book. A handson, projectbased introduction to programming. Mar 21, 2017 a byte of python is a free book on programming using the python language. There is a lot of material on scratch programming on the internet, including videos, online courses, scratch projects, and so on, but, most of it is introductory. Cryptography and network security 5th edition book. Eloquent python eloquent python like a professional oneliners python python 3. By the end of this book, youll have built up an impressive portfolio of projects and armed yourself with the skills you need to tackle python projects in the real world. A byte of python is a free book on programming using the python language.

329 28 958 802 1020 346 1179 1080 390 1049 375 1083 545 123 1347 1430 818 215 1336 386 901 105 496 1048 955 1261 1285 1420 967 734 965 570 947 640 89 1111 70 1118 399 367 468 1486 1305